The New Orleans Saints offense is rejuvenated for 2023. They have a proven quarterback in Derek Carr. Their offensive line looks to be healthy and revitalized. The weapons on offense are impressive as well, especially if Michael Thomas stays healthy. Tight end Foster Moreau and running back Jamaal Williams are primed to have a legit impact as new pieces. 

One returning wide receiver is already making waves at practice, though. There are gleaming reports regarding young receiver/returner Rashid Shaheed. 

Shaheed totaled 488 receiving yards as a rookie last season. He was signed as a UDFA by the Saints and became an important piece for them on offense and special teams. Alongside Chris Olave, the duo can provide a special vertical game for the Saints and Derek Carr. 

Shaheed was an explosive player for New Orleans last season. It sounds like there's more of that coming for him and the Saints this season. Keep an eye on him as the season approaches.
